Business Analyst Jobs in Melville, NY
A Business Analyst in the logistics industry analyses the business needs and problems of a company and devises strategies to solve them, thereby improving the company's business operations. They play a crucial role in bridging the gap between IT and the business using data analytics to assess processes, determine requirements and deliver data-driven recommendations to executives and stakeholders. Their key responsibilities include strategic planning, process modelling, requirement analysis, and data modelling. They also manage project documentation and other relevant information. An analyst must be able to interpret and use data to help the company make well-informed decisions.
Important skills for a Business Analyst include strong analytical skills, problem-solving abilities, excellent communication and negotiation skills, and proficiency in business intelligence software. A professional certification such as Certified Business Analysis Professional (CBAP) or Certification of Competency in Business Analysis (CCBA) is essential to validate their expertise. Additionally, familiarity with logistics and supply chain management software like SAP or Oracle is beneficial. Prior to becoming a business analyst, a person may have roles such as Data Analyst, Project Coordinator, or Operations Manager that provide the necessary experience and skills.
